What are the key technical specifications to consider when selecting Kum Connectors for industrial applications?
When sourcing Kum Connectors, you must prioritize electrical conductivity and insulation resistance. Ensure the connectors use high-grade copper alloys with tin or gold plating to prevent oxidation. For automotive or heavy machinery use, verify the current rating (Amps) and voltage capacity to match your system requirements. Additionally, check for housing materials like PBT or Nylon 66, which offer high thermal stability and chemical resistance.
How can I ensure the Kum Connectors meet international safety and quality standards?
Compliance is non-negotiable in cross-border trade. You should verify that the products adhere to ISO 9001:2015 for quality management and IATF 16949 if they are intended for the automotive supply chain. Ensure the materials are RoHS and REACH compliant to avoid environmental regulatory issues in the EU and US markets. Always request UL or CE certification reports from the supplier before finalizing the contract.
What environmental factors affect the performance and longevity of Kum Connectors?
The durability of a connector is often defined by its IP (Ingress Protection) rating. For outdoor or harsh environments, look for IP67 or IP68 ratings to ensure protection against dust and water immersion. Furthermore, evaluate the operating temperature range (typically -40°C to +125°C for automotive grades) and vibration resistance, which is critical for maintaining a stable connection in moving machinery.

What are the primary risks when purchasing Kum Connectors from overseas suppliers?
The biggest risks include counterfeit components and material substitution. To mitigate this, use Made-in-China.com's 'Audited Supplier' reports to verify the factory's legitimacy. Always request a pre-shipment inspection (PSI) to ensure the batch matches the approved gold sample, focusing on terminal crimping quality and housing fit.
How should I negotiate pricing and MOQs for bulk connector orders?
Connectors are high-volume, low-margin items. Negotiate based on annual volume forecasts rather than single orders to secure tier-based pricing (15-25% discounts). If the supplier's Minimum Order Quantity (MOQ) is too high, suggest a staggered delivery schedule or ask to use 'neutral packaging' to reduce their setup costs.
What are the best practices for shipping and logistics to ensure product integrity?
Connectors are sensitive to moisture and physical deformation. Insist on vacuum-sealed moisture-barrier bags and anti-static packaging. For shipping to specific regions, choose FOB (Free On Board) terms to maintain control over the freight forwarder, and ensure the outer cartons are double-walled corrugated fiberboard to prevent crushing during transit.
